技术文摘
MySQL 函数详细讲解
MySQL 函数详细讲解
MySQL 函数是数据库操作中极为实用的工具,它能帮助我们更高效地处理和分析数据。下面就来详细介绍几种常见的 MySQL 函数。
首先是数值函数。ABS 函数用于返回一个数的绝对值,比如 ABS(-5) 会返回 5。ROUND 函数则用于对数字进行四舍五入,ROUND(3.14159, 2) 会返回 3.14,这里的第二个参数指定了保留的小数位数。还有 CEIL 和 FLOOR 函数,CEIL(3.1) 会返回 4,即向上取整;FLOOR(3.9) 会返回 3,也就是向下取整。
字符串函数同样十分常用。CONCAT 函数可以将多个字符串连接成一个,例如 CONCAT('Hello', ', ', 'World') 会返回 'Hello, World'。LENGTH 函数用于返回字符串的长度,LENGTH('MySQL') 会返回 5。SUBSTRING 函数则用于提取字符串的子串,SUBSTRING('abcdef', 2, 3) 会从位置 2 开始提取 3 个字符,返回 'bcd'。
日期和时间函数在处理包含时间的数据时非常关键。CURRENT_DATE 函数返回当前的日期,CURRENT_TIME 函数返回当前的时间,而 NOW 函数则返回当前的日期和时间。DATE_FORMAT 函数可以按照指定的格式显示日期,例如 DATE_FORMAT(NOW(), '%Y-%m-%d') 会以 “年-月-日” 的格式显示当前日期。
聚合函数在数据分析中发挥着重要作用。SUM 函数用于计算某一列的总和,比如 SUM(price) 可以求出商品价格的总和。AVG 函数用于计算平均值,AVG(score) 能得到成绩的平均值。COUNT 函数用于统计记录的数量,COUNT(*) 可以统计表中的总行数。MAX 和 MIN 函数分别用于获取某一列的最大值和最小值,比如 MAX(salary) 能找出最高工资,MIN(salary) 则能找出最低工资。
掌握这些 MySQL 函数,能极大地提升我们对数据库的操作能力,无论是数据的清洗、计算还是分析,都能更加得心应手。无论是初学者还是有一定经验的开发者,不断深入学习和运用这些函数,都能为数据库相关的工作带来更高的效率和质量。
- 必看的 Rect 面试题,赶紧收藏
- 10 岁女孩成程序员,拒谷歌 Offer 创首款 AI 桌游
- Adobe 十大 PS 新神技惊艳亮相
- 过年回家抢票,12306 余票计算方式及思路解析
- 10 个必知的 PHP 开源比特币项目
- 重新探讨前后端 API 签名安全问题
- 10 个实用案例,助 Python 小白轻松入门
- 自学 Python 爬虫达到何种程度能找工作?
- 陈威如:在阿里的最大启示——“看十年做一年”
- GitHub 宕机 24 小时 程序员通宵抢修
- Python 畅玩烧脑《一笔画完》,轻松突破 100 关
- 那些令 Java 程序员心动的 Scala 绝技
- 单屏页面响应式适配策略
- 资深码农畅聊后端世界
- 1024 程序员节:今日不加班,紧急通知!